mirror of https://gitee.com/bigwinds/arangodb
41 lines
3.6 KiB
Plaintext
41 lines
3.6 KiB
Plaintext
arangosh> <span class="hljs-keyword">var</span> graph_module = <span class="hljs-built_in">require</span>(<span class="hljs-string">"@arangodb/general-graph"</span>);
|
|
arangosh> graph = graph_module._create(<span class="hljs-string">"myGraph"</span>,
|
|
........> [graph_module._relation(<span class="hljs-string">"myRelation"</span>, [<span class="hljs-string">"male"</span>, <span class="hljs-string">"female"</span>], [<span class="hljs-string">"male"</span>, <span class="hljs-string">"female"</span>])], [<span class="hljs-string">"sessions"</span>]);
|
|
{
|
|
<span class="hljs-string">"_edgeCollections"</span> : () { ... },
|
|
<span class="hljs-string">"_vertexCollections"</span> : (excludeOrphans) { ... },
|
|
<span class="hljs-string">"_EDGES"</span> : (vertexId) { ... },
|
|
<span class="hljs-string">"_INEDGES"</span> : (vertexId) { ... },
|
|
<span class="hljs-string">"_OUTEDGES"</span> : (vertexId) { ... },
|
|
<span class="hljs-string">"_edges"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_vertices"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_fromVertex"</span> : (edgeId) { ... },
|
|
<span class="hljs-string">"_toVertex"</span> : (edgeId) { ... },
|
|
<span class="hljs-string">"_getEdgeCollectionByName"</span> : (name) { ... },
|
|
<span class="hljs-string">"_getVertexCollectionByName"</span> : (name) { ... },
|
|
<span class="hljs-string">"_neighbors"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_commonNeighbors"</span> : (vertex1Example, vertex2Example, optionsVertex1, optionsVertex2) { ... },
|
|
<span class="hljs-string">"_countCommonNeighbors"</span> : (vertex1Example, vertex2Example, optionsVertex1, optionsVertex2) { ... },
|
|
<span class="hljs-string">"_commonProperties"</span> : (vertex1Example, vertex2Example, options) { ... },
|
|
<span class="hljs-string">"_countCommonProperties"</span> : (vertex1Example, vertex2Example, options) { ... },
|
|
<span class="hljs-string">"_paths"</span> : (options) { ... },
|
|
<span class="hljs-string">"_shortestPath"</span> : (startVertexExample, endVertexExample, options) { ... },
|
|
<span class="hljs-string">"_distanceTo"</span> : (startVertexExample, endVertexExample, options) { ... },
|
|
<span class="hljs-string">"_absoluteEccentricity"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_farness"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_absoluteCloseness"</span> : (vertexExample, options) { ... },
|
|
<span class="hljs-string">"_eccentricity"</span> : (options) { ... },
|
|
<span class="hljs-string">"_closeness"</span> : (options) { ... },
|
|
<span class="hljs-string">"_absoluteBetweenness"</span> : (example, options) { ... },
|
|
<span class="hljs-string">"_betweenness"</span> : (options) { ... },
|
|
<span class="hljs-string">"_radius"</span> : (options) { ... },
|
|
<span class="hljs-string">"_diameter"</span> : (options) { ... },
|
|
<span class="hljs-string">"_extendEdgeDefinitions"</span> : (edgeDefinition) { ... },
|
|
<span class="hljs-string">"_editEdgeDefinitions"</span> : (edgeDefinition) { ... },
|
|
<span class="hljs-string">"_deleteEdgeDefinition"</span> : (edgeCollection, dropCollection) { ... },
|
|
<span class="hljs-string">"_addVertexCollection"</span> : (vertexCollectionName, createCollection) { ... },
|
|
<span class="hljs-string">"_orphanCollections"</span> : () { ... },
|
|
<span class="hljs-string">"_removeVertexCollection"</span> : (vertexCollectionName, dropCollection) { ... },
|
|
<span class="hljs-string">"_getConnectingEdges"</span> : (vertexExample1, vertexExample2, options) { ... }
|
|
}
|